MATTHEW BURGOYNE: Good day, I’m Matthew Burgoyne, Co-Chair of the Digital Property and Blockchain Group at Osler in Calgary.
An crucial query within the cryptocurrency business is when precisely does a token turn into a safety? That is related for Canadian token issuers, the Canadian Securities Directors, the SEC within the U.S. and naturally Binance and Coinbase, who have been each just lately sued by the SEC on the premise that they engaged in, amongst different issues, unregistered choices of safety tokens. The current resolution from a U.S. courtroom on the SEC Ripple dispute might doubtlessly influence how we reply that query, particularly with reference to the “funding contract” check.
The funding contract check is an important instrument in figuring out whether or not the style wherein a token is offered constitutes a distribution of a safety. In Canada, the Supreme Courtroom determined within the “Pacific Coin” case that an funding contract arises when the entire following have been met: There was:
- an funding of cash,
- in a typical enterprise,
- with the expectation of revenue
- to return considerably from the efforts of others.
July 13, 2023, noticed a landmark ruling by america District Courtroom. It declared that Ripple Labs’s XRP token constituted a safety when offered to institutional traders, thereby falling below SEC oversight. Nonetheless, when offered on a digital alternate or through a buying and selling algorithm to most of the people, the token was not deemed to be a safety.
The courtroom held that the information surrounding the sale of the token are important to understanding whether or not the token is an funding contract, because the token “will not be in and of itself a ‘contract, or scheme or transaction’ that embodies the necessities of an funding contract.”
Institutional consumers would have fairly anticipated that Ripple would use the proceeds for the XRP ecosystem, which might probably end in a rise within the token’s worth, in response to the courtroom.
However those that bought the tokens on crypto exchanges did not essentially know if their funds for XRP went to Ripple or another vendor because the crypto exchanges used buying and selling algorithms that matched consumers and sellers in blind transactions. Due to this fact, there wouldn’t essentially have been any expectation of revenue coming considerably from Ripple’s efforts.
So, what does this imply for Canadians?
The Ripple verdict affords Canadian regulators and market members meals for thought. If related rules have been utilized in Canada, sure tokens offered on digital exchanges to the general public through buying and selling algorithms might evade being labeled as securities. Conversely, if offered to institutional traders with the promise that sale proceeds will likely be used to additional develop the token ecosystem, they could be considered securities. This may pave the best way for a extra nuanced method in crypto asset classification.
The absence of a coherent, globally utilized method to crypto asset creation and distribution, forces regulators to suit crypto asset laws into the normal capital markets regime on a case-by-case foundation.
Right here is the underside line:
- Canadian token distributors must be cautious and search authorized recommendation earlier than initiating any token distribution occasion, even when the distribution takes place offshore.
- Be ready to defend towards the argument that your undertaking is distributing an funding contract. If there’s an identifiable group or individual whose efforts are important for the success or failure of the undertaking, it’s best to acquire authorized recommendation. Canadian securities regulators are monitoring the business carefully, and the penalties and sanctions for noncompliance might be expensive.
